[QUOTE="billsin01, post: 5050636, member: 837"] I think there's a bunch of factors here. You point out one of them which is where are we trying to force guys and how are we playing it to make sure they go where we want them to go. Another is when to help. We saw a lot of teams this year cheat early against Judah, before he ever started his drive, knowing that keeping him from getting to the paint ensured more jump shots and fewer fouls. Yes, Bell and JJ both took advantage of this with open or decent looks at threes, but Judah living in the paint was a worst-case scenario for an opponent. Our help was often non-existent or too late to do much but foul. We also played terribly against screens off-ball on the wings, which led to our players often chasing the play from behind. Judah and JJ were chasing the ball-handler down the lane most of the year. Tough to adjust to that for the other four guys. There's a lot of work to be done for Red and co. Thought we got better as the year went on, but losing Brown and Copeland and even Judah when he decided to play defense, is going to be difficult. [/QUOTE]
